For me, the LOP command is that I’m not able to scrub very far in the track. Like, say I want to use the duck fartz sound - I’m not able to seek to it. However, if I use the LT1 command, then I can.
LT1 is the command for LFO1 to retrig at a given offset. This means we can tell the LFO to start at the middle, which starts the sample playback at the middle. So with the duckfartz loop - offset 40 is the start of the second bar (25% of 256 (0xFF), 80 for the third bar, and C0 for the forth. With a 4 bar loop, every every change with edit+up offsets the start by a quarter note - which I find very easy to map in my head.
